By default, TestGPT will use the OpenAI gpt-3.5-turbo-16k model, but you can use gpt-4, or any other model you want. Installation VSCode Extension An extension is available on the VSCode Marketplace or install directly by entering this command in the VSCode command palette (Command+P) / (Ctrl+P): CLI Tool To install the CLI tool, follow those steps 1. Install TestGPT by running one of these commands: 2. Get your OpenAI API Key by requesting access to the OpenAI API and obtaining your API key. Then export it based on your OS: - macOS or Linux: Add the following line to .zshrc or .bashrc in your home directory: Then run the command: - Windows: Go to System - Settings - Advanced - Environment Variables, click New under System Variables, and create a new entry with the key OPENAI API KEY and your OpenAI API Key as the value. Usage Universal / Plug and Play Here's a simple form of a test generation command: With more options, comes more power! You can easily specify target techs, tips, and specify a custom GPT model, along with other options. Here is a breakdown table: --inputFile -i [ Required ] Path for the input file to be tested (e.g. ./Button.tsx ). --outputFile -o [ Default: {inputFile}.test.{extension} ] Path for the output file where the generated tests will be written (e.g. ./Button.spec.tsx ).
